I am an avid teapot collector and have recently done my bedroom in blue and beige. The color of the lamp is definitely blue and beige and not blue and white as it is described (unless the color swatch is one of those fancy white terms). The lampshade arrived torn but I didn't feel like going through the process of returning it for that reason. This the second one that I ordered in less than a month. It is beautiful and would definitely order another one if it came in another color.

The body of the lamp is cute, although why they call it white and blue is a mystery to me. The harp is too short and should be replaced because you cannot screw in a normal -sized bulb. Then, once you get a bigger harp, the shade doesn't fall right. Also, the shade is paper-thin and it came damaged where it split at the seams. In other words, it looks much better in the picture than what comes in the mail.
